Ayuso storms to Tour of Romandie time trial win

Juan Ayuso blitzed the 18.5km particular person time trial on stage three of the Tour de Romandie on Friday to take the general lead of the race.

Normally a robust climber, Ayuso was modest in his ambition to defend his lead on Saturday’s stage over 5 Alpine climbs on the best way to the ski resort of Thyon at an altitude of 2,076m.

“On short efforts like today I can perform at my best, but tomorrow in the mountains will be more representative of my form,” stated Ayuso after simply his third aggressive day within the saddle of 2023.

“If I can’t win I’ll go all in for Adam (Yates). I’ll try and defend the yellow jersey, it’s a very good opportunity for the team.”

To declare his first World Tour triumph Friday, Ayuso accomplished the largely flat time trial in 25min 15sec in a rural setting within the French-speaking half of Switzerland, with much less cornering than an city route, and fewer highway furnishings.

Matteo Jorgenson of Movistar was second at 5 seconds whereas Ayuso’s teammate Yates was third at 17sec.

Ayuso leads the general standings by 18sec from Jorgenson with world time trial champion Tobias Foss in third at 19sec.

Chris Froome, a four-time Tour de France winner, completed 3min 19sec down as he seeks a begin place on the Israel Premier Tech workforce for the Tour this yr.

After Saturday’s likely decisive stage, Sunday’s finale is a 170km run to Geneva over two categorised climbs.
